<strong>Personal Injury Protection</strong>
</td>
<td width="85%" valign="top"><strong>Optional:</strong></p>
<p>Basic PIP is optional   in Washington.   PIP coverage applies to you, your family, and any passengers covered under   your policy, regardless of who is responsible for the accident. PIP will pay   the following benefits, up to the limits of your policy, for losses or   expenses incurred because of injuries sustained by an insured person as a   result of an auto accident:</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Medical Benefits</span>- Up to $10,000 for one insured person</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Income Continuation Benefits</span>- Up to $10,000 for one insured person who   is employed at the time of the accident, up to a limit of $200 per week and   not exceeding 85% of the insured person’s weekly income at the time of the   accident.  Begins 14 days after the accident and continue for up to 52   weeks.</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Funeral Expenses</span>- Up to $2,000 payment for reasonable expenses</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Loss of Service Benefits</span>- Up to $5,000 for services that you would   have performed without income if you had not been injured in the accident but   are now making payments to persons other than members of your household to   perform.  Loss of services benefits are subject to a limit of $40 per   day, not to exceed $200 per week.  Begin on date of the accident and   continue for up to 52 weeks.</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td width="25%" valign="top">
<strong>Additional Personal Injury</strong>
</td>
<td width="85%" valign="top">Additional   PIP can be purchased with the same benefits as described in basic PIP, except   limits are increased as follows:</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Medical Benefits</span>- Up to $35,000</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Income Continuation Benefits</span>- Up to $35,000 up to a limit of the   lesser of $700 per week or 85% of the insured person’s weekly income.</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Funeral Expenses</span>- Up to $2,000</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Loss of Service Benefits</span>- Up to $40 per day for up to one year from   date of accident</td>

<strong>Personal Injury Protection</strong>
</td>
<td width="75%" valign="top"><strong>Mandatory:</strong></p>
<p>Basic   PIP is mandatory in the state of Utah.   Also known as No-Fault, this coverage applies to you, your family, and any   passengers covered under your policy, regardless of who is responsible for   the accident. Basic PIP will pay the following benefits, up to the limits of   your policy, for losses or expenses incurred because of injuries sustained by   an insured person as a result of an auto accident:</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Medical Benefits</span>- Up to $3,000 per person for reasonable and necessary   expenses for medical, surgical, x-ray, dental, rehabilitation, including   prosthetic devices, ambulance, hospital, and nursing services.</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Lost Income Benefits</span>- the lesser of $250 per week or 85% of any loss   of gross income and loss of earning capacity per person from inability to   work, for a maximum of 52 consecutive weeks after the loss.</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Funeral Expenses</span>- Funeral, burial, or cremation benefits up to a total   of $1,500 per person.</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Survivor Loss Benefits</span>- Up to $3,000</p>
<p><strong>Reject   Loss of Income Benefits:</strong></p>
<p>You   also have the option to reject Loss of Income Benefits.  You will need   to provide proof within 31 days of applying for coverage that neither the   insured not the insured’s spouse received any earned income from regular   employment, and for at least the next 180 days during the period of   insurance, neither the insured nor the insured’s spouse will receive earned   income from regular payment.</td>

<strong>Personal Injury Protection:</strong><br />
<strong>You cannot have PIP and   Med Pay on the same policy!</strong>
</td>
<td width="75%" valign="top"><strong>Optional:</strong></p>
<p>This coverage is   optional in the state of Texas.    Regardless of who is at fault, PIP covers bodily injury to covered persons   caused by an accident involving an insured private passenger motor vehicle,   up to your policy limits.  PIP also covers bodily injury resulting from   an accident involving a motor vehicle to:</p>
<p>●          You while in another person’s vehicle.</p>
<p>●          You as a pedestrian or bicyclist.</p>
<p>●          Your relatives living in your home.</p>
<p>●          Certain passengers who do not have PIP/</p>
<p>●          Certain licensed drivers who drive your vehicle with your permission</p>
<p>PIP Covers:</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Medical Expenses</span>- up to $10,000</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Work Loss</span>- 80% of lost income</p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Funeral Expenses</span></p>
<p>●          <span style="text-decoration: underline;">Essential Services</span>- the cost of hiring someone to take over the   household and caregiver responsibilities of the injured person.</p>
<p>The   minimum PIP offered is $2,500.  You may reject the coverage in writing   or opt for increased limits.  Payment will only be made for losses or   expenses incurred within three (3) years from the date of the accident.</td>
